About this role

Crisis Intervention Specialist Function: Immediate response Position Summary:

The Crisis Intervention Specialist provides immediate,short-term, on-site therapeutic and behavioral stabilization support to students experiencing significant emotional or behavioral dysregulation. The Specialist works alongside school staff to model effective de-escalation, support implementation of individualized plans, and assist students in safely returning to instruction whenever possible.This position focuses on stabilization, coaching, and implementation rather than long-term case management. Key Responsibilities:

• Respond rapidly to schools during active behavioral or emotional crises

• Implement de-escalation and co-regulation strategies

• Support safe environments for students and staff during high-intensity situations

• Assist in maintaining safety while minimizing the need for restraint

• Model effective crisis response strategies for school-based staff

• Participate in post-incident debriefs and contribute to planning

Qualifications:

• Bachelor's degree required; Master's degree preferred (education, psychology, social work,Experience working with students with significant behavioral or emotional needs

• Licensure required (e.g DESE School School Social Worker/ School Counselor)

• Moderate special needs certification

• Training in crisis prevention/intervention (e.g., CPI, Safety-Care, or similar)

• Ability to remain calm and responsive in high-stress situation
